Congratulations on your Clean Ocean! I love Oris watches!
I have the Clean Ocean, it was part of the "Trilogy" set which also included the Great Barrier Reef III at 43.5mm and the Blue Whale chrono at 45.5mm. Oris did a great job making each watch unique yet similar. Besides the blue dials, the big thing that grabbed me is the turquoise color on the ceramic dial. The fourth one in the picture is the Clipperton Edition. I also have the GMT. |
